In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ts. Hyundai ix35 might be a better choice in this respect. | |||
Hydraulic tappets: | yes | no | |
The Hyundai ix35 engine has hydraulic tappets (lifters), providing quieter operation and no need for periodic adjustment, but they are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in case of failure. | |||
